Luno's referral programme rewards both you and an eligible new user when they join through your invite and complete the required qualifying steps. See what you can earn:
You receive RM50 worth of Bitcoin after a successful eligible referral.
Your friend also receives RM50 worth of Bitcoin.
Share your unique invite link or referral code directly from your Luno account.
Your referral is more likely to be useful when shared with friends who are already considering investing in cryptocurrency, exploring crypto trading or looking for a platform to buy Bitcoin. They already have a reason to open an account, so the RM50 Bitcoin reward becomes an additional benefit rather than the main reason for joining.
This approach also keeps the referral practical. Instead of encouraging someone to invest simply for the reward, share your code with people who have already shown an interest in crypto and can decide whether Luno suits their needs.
AirAsia BIG Points can be exchanged for a Luno voucher worth up to RM50 OFF your first Bitcoin purchase. If you already have points approaching expiry, redeeming them for this offer gives them practical value instead of letting them go unused, particularly if you have been considering your first cryptocurrency investment.
Depositing RM100 or more into Luno through FPX or Touch 'n Go comes with no deposit fee, while withdrawals cost only RM0.10. Keeping transaction costs low means more of your money remains available for investing, making regular deposits much more efficient over time.
